Default Looking to buy..need some info/advise

Hi guys, just joined. Looking to buy a 2007 GT. I was wondering if I could pick your brains for some info. The stereo in the car is a shaker..question is..should it have a subwoofer in the trunk? There is a **** on the console at my right knee, is that a sub volume control? What is the difference between a deluxe and a premium package? The mirrors don't have lights in them, is this the cheap model or is that the way they all are? The exhaust tips are just regular pipes, I've seen rolled tips, should they be on there? What options should I look for? I have the car for the weekend to make sure that I'll be happy with it. This car only has 3500 miles on it. It's at a dealer. What can I expect to pay? He's asking $24,900. Sorry for all the questions, I just want to make sure I'm making a good decision. I might have a lot more questions as I go along. Thanks a lot.

there may be an aftermarket sub in the trunk or it is wired for one but normally it wont come with one
unless its the Shaker 1000 then it has a sub in the trunk but the bass is adjusted through the radio

Deluxe and premium, pretty much the premium is going to give you the leather seats and the nicer dash and the my color option where you can change your gauge color

The mirrors dont have lights on them on any model

the nicer tips only come on the better models like the California special or the shelby etc...

i recommend getting a full exhaust with tips to make her purr

if its a 2007, you may want to negotiate the price a bit. it does have low miles but the year does say a lot about the car, its already 3 years old.

As for the price of $24,900, it seems high. Is this a premium GT? If it's not, then its way over priced. You can normally tell, if A. has leather seats B. you see the "info button" on your center console. In the center of the dash, you will see 4 gauges instead of 2, and 2 message screens under the speedo.

You can tell if it has the comfort package if it has heated seats, powered passenger seat, upgraded rear view mirror.

You can tell if it has the security package buy looking where the overhead lights are. You will see two sensors, one on each side covered by a little grid.

Can't really think of anything off the top of my head, but feel free if you have any questions. Also read through the TSB. Not sure if you know about the dreaded water leak. Something to look out for.

The security and comfort packages are add-ons. So it looks like you may have a standard premium package. Is it a shaker 500 or 1000? Do you have 8 speakers or 4? 4 stock speakers would be deluxe and 8 stock speakers would be premium.

The vanity mirrors.. I believe they did not light up. I have to check on that one.

From what I recall, there is v6, v6 deluxe, v6 pony package, GT deluxe and GT premium. Ford made it so confusing.
